Transaction 80dfee0976ce924ba0c68f3a5a03378e1d4e468da3ce9d24b78c4d77ae7146ee

5 Input
2 Outputs
  • 80dfee0976ce924ba0c68f3a5a03378e1d4e468da3ce9d24b78c4d77ae7146ee:0
  • value  2158661
    address  3FyLC3kkv2PCFY567Bt5XykncbWtXNH2Ak
  • 80dfee0976ce924ba0c68f3a5a03378e1d4e468da3ce9d24b78c4d77ae7146ee:1
  • value  374449
    address  3PxTQc25ZAnNTGUoemhovCUeN4y2kGXz5J